Registered Nursing at Louisiana State University-Eunice

If you plan to study Registered Nursing, consider the program at Louisiana State University-Eunice. The following information will help you decide if it is a good fit for you.

Louisiana State University-Eunice is located in Eunice, LA.

During the most recent reporting year, 76 registered nursing degrees were awarded at Louisiana State University-Eunice.

Studying Online at Louisiana State University-Eunice

Online coursework is an option at Louisiana State University-Eunice. Of 3,670 students, 1,170 (32%) studied exclusively online and 1,156 (31%) took at least some classes online.

Student Demographics & Diversity

Take a look at the diversity of Registered Nursing graduates at Louisiana State University-Eunice, broken down by degree level.

Across all degree levels, Registered Nursing graduates at Louisiana State University-Eunice are 91% women (69) and 9% men (7).

Registered Nursing Associate’s Program at Louisiana State University-Eunice

Among the 76 associate’s registered nursing graduates at Louisiana State University-Eunice, 91% were women (69) and 9% were men (7).

The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Registered Nursing associate’s degree recipients at Louisiana State University-Eunice.

Race / Ethnicity Number of Graduates
White 56
Hispanic / Latino 2
Black / African American 14
Asian 2
Two or More Races 1
Unknown 1
Racial-ethnic diversity of Registered Nursing majors at Louisiana State University-Eunice

Minority students account for 25% of Registered Nursing associate’s degree recipients at Louisiana State University-Eunice, below the national average of 43%.*

*The racial-ethnic minorities figure is the total number of graduates minus White, international (nonresident), and unknown-race graduates.
